Dual SLI graphics; strong mobile gaming scores; 10-key number pad; integrated Logitech GamePanel LCD; multicolored, built-in LED lights play along with music and games; backlit keyboard; can play media files without booting up.
Similarly configured laptops are faster on some tests; plastic lid and creaky hinges don't scream (or sound like) luxury; the albatross that is the massive power brick.
With a redesigned case that's chock-full of cutting-edge technologies, the Dell XPS M1730 tops our list of our favorite gaming laptops.

dell xps m1730 review: When most desktop replacements tend to target power users or entertainment seekers, the Dell XPS M1730 makes no bones about being a gaming machine.
Excellent gaming performance, Inexpensive for a high-end dual graphics card system, Options for Intel Core 2 Extreme processor and Blu-ray drive, Backlit keyboard, GamePanel LCD as a secondary data display, High-resolution 1920x1200 panel
Barely portable, No subwoofer, Lacks TV tuner, Noisy particularly when running full load
When most desktop replacements tend to target power users or entertainment seekers, the Dell XPS M1730 makes no bones about being a gaming machine. At under AU$3,000 for the base configuration with dual graphics cards, it offers great value for the gaming...
